AI Contract Overview
The contract involves providing specialized packaging, preservation, and labeling services for industrial components, with a focus on ensuring adherence to Department of Defense and federal hazardous materials regulations. This effort is crucial to maintaining safety and compliance standards when handling materials that pose potential hazards, particularly within defense-related operations. The services will be performed as a subcontract under the NAICS code 541620, which pertains to environmental consulting and other related services. The place of performance is specified as Kings Bay, with the ZIP code 31547-2631, indicating that work will be conducted at or near this location. The contract was posted on May 22, 2026, and responses are due by May 28, 2026, highlighting a relatively short window for bids or proposals. The contracting agency is the Electrical Devices Division of the Department of Defense, emphasizing that this contract supports military and defense infrastructure requirements. No specific set-aside details or a named point of contact are provided in the available information.
